Gross Tumor Volume Segmentation - (DICOM RTSTRUCT and SEG,  912 MB)

Corresponding Original CT Images from RIDER Lung CT - (DICOM, 7 GB)

Click the Versions tab for more info about data releases.


Note

  • (RIDER-2283289298) only has segmentations associated with the retest.

  • (RIDER-5195703382) only has segmentations associated with the test.

  • (RIDER-8509201188) only has segmentations associated with the test.

  • (RIDER-9762593735) not included in the data set due to missing delineations.
